The true value of a design asset lies in its utility. This icon package is delivered as a zip file containing 5 different formats: AI, EPS, JPG, PNG (Transparent Background), SVG. This breadth of formats is what makes it suitable for virtually any workflow.
- For Web Designers & Developers: The SVG (Scalable Vector Graphics) format is perfect for websites and web apps. It scales infinitely without losing quality, loads quickly, and can be easily styled with CSS. Use it for venue locator maps, contact page icons, or as a bullet point in feature lists for wedding planning services.
- For App Developers: The PNG with a transparent background is ideal for mobile app interfaces. It integrates seamlessly onto any colored screen or background, perfect for a "Find Venue" button or a location tag in a photo gallery.
- For Marketers & Content Creators: The JPG and PNG files are ready for immediate use in social media graphics, blog post headers, email newsletters, and digital presentations. They help create visual consistency across your social media graphics and digital ads.
- For Print & Packaging Design: The AI and EPS vector formats are essential for high-resolution print work. They allow for endless scaling, making the icon perfect for business cards, brochures, wedding stationery, and even packaging design for favors or products. The vector paths ensure sharp edges on any printed material.

Integrating Icons into Your Design Strategy
Using an icon effectively is about more than just placement; it's about integration. The Wedding Location Greyscale Line Icon works best when it supports your content rather than competes with it. Its line weight and style should harmonize with your chosen typeface. For instance, pairing it with a clean sans serif font creates a modern, airy feel. If your brand uses a serif font for a more traditional look, the icon's simplicity can provide a nice contemporary counterpoint.
Think about visual hierarchy. An icon can draw attention to a key piece of information, like a venue address or a "Get Directions" call-to-action. In a dense block of text, it provides a necessary visual break, improving readability and helping to organize information. When creating templates for presentation slides or social media posts, having a consistent set of icons like this one ensures every piece of content feels part of a unified whole.
Before finalizing your choice, evaluate the icon against your project's needs. Does its symbolic meaning align perfectly with your message? Test it at various sizes to ensure the details remain clear. While this is a greyscale icon, consider how it might look if you were to add a single brand color to it in software like Adobe Illustrator (using the AI or EPS file) for a monochromatic variation. Always review the licensing to confirm it covers your intended use, whether for personal crafting projects or commercial client work.
